فهرست منبع

검색색인쿼리

eskim 5 سال پیش
والد
کامیت
16a63906be
1فایلهای تغییر یافته به همراه4 افزوده شده و 2 حذف شده
  1. 4 2
      산출물/검색/검색_상품색인.sql

+ 4 - 2
산출물/검색/검색_상품색인.sql

@@ -73,7 +73,7 @@ SELECT DISTINCT  G.GOODS_CD
                                                 FROM  VW_STOCK
                                                 WHERE GOODS_CD = G.GOODS_CD
                                                 AND OPT_CD1 =  (CASE WHEN G.SELF_GOODS_YN = 'N' THEN OPT_CD1 
-                                                                     ELSE  IFNULL(G.MAIN_COLOR_CD,'00') END)
+                                                                     ELSE  IFNULL(G.MAIN_COLOR_CD,'XX') END)
                                                 GROUP BY GOODS_CD )
             ELSE (SELECT IFNULL(MAX(CASE WHEN SOLDOUT_YN = 'Y' THEN 0
                                       ELSE CURR_STOCK_QTY
@@ -83,7 +83,9 @@ SELECT DISTINCT  G.GOODS_CD
                   GROUP BY GOODS_CD )
             END) AS STOCK_QTY
        , K.AD_KEYWORD
-       , 'COUPON 노출' AS COUPON_ICON
+       , FN_IS_GOODS_COUPON('P',G.GOODS_CD, BP.CURR_PRICE) AS COUPON_PC_ICON
+       , FN_IS_GOODS_COUPON('M',G.GOODS_CD, BP.CURR_PRICE) AS COUPON_MO_ICON
+       , FN_IS_GOODS_COUPON('A',G.GOODS_CD, BP.CURR_PRICE) AS COUPON_APP_ICON
        , (CASE WHEN BP.CURR_PRICE <= E.MIN_ORD_AMT THEN 'Y' ELSE 'N' END) AS DELV_FREE_ICON
        , FN_GET_FREEGIFT_GOODS_YN(G.GOODS_CD) AS FREEGIFT_ICON
        , (CASE WHEN G.FORMAL_GB = 'G009_10' THEN 'Y' ELSE 'N' END) AS NEW_GOODS_ICON